When and what time is Zimbabwe ladies playing against Australia..Today, Tuesday, 9th August 2016 at 8PM

Zim Mighty Warriors Play Australia Today

After some tough matches between Zimbabwe and Germany-Canada, our ladies are expected to give their best as they take on the girls in gold and green.

The Matildas, as the Australian ladies line up is called are ranked 10th in the world.

As usual goals are expected to rain in the encounter.

Zimbabwe is already eliminated but will play an important part as Germany, Canada and Australia are still playing to finish in the top two in order to qualify for the knockout stages.

Here are the names of the Zimbabwe Mighty Warriors Squad

Kudakwashe Bhasopo, Eunice Chibanda, Chido Dzingirai, Erina Jeke, Daisy Kaitano, Rejoice Kapfumvuti, Lindiwe Magwede, Rutendo Makore, Sheila Makoto, Talent Mandaza, Emmaculate Msipa, Lynett Mutokuto, Felistas Muzongondi, Rudo Neshamba, Marjory Nyaumwe, Samkelisiwe Zulu, Mavis Chirandu, Nobuhle Majika.

The Zimbabwean side has received a lot of praise and support from home fans who have been pleased with the ‘game spirit’ despite heavy losses.

However there is a small section of supporters who feel that there should not be any excuse for losing against the world’s top ranked sides.

To counter this negativity some have pointed to the performance of the much loved Dream Team of Fabisch who never qualified for any major tournament.

They even got eliminated by a poor Cameroon that went on to get a 6-1 hammering from low ranked Russia at the 1994 World Cup Finals in US.

Whatever opinion people have of these ladies, they have done well given lack of resources and the fact that the entire team including coaches is made up of amateurs and part timers who have full time occupations in non sporting disciplines.

Following Zimbabwe’s 1-6 loss to Germany in the opening match, FIFA congratulated Zimbabwe for showing resilience and playing beyond expectations.
